Click for WNYC radio interview on June 30, 2011
 Pentagon Papers Legacy and WikiLeaks

Brian Lehrer, of WNYC radio, interviews James Goodale on the 40th anniversary of the U.S. Supreme Court's decision on the Pentagon Papers. 

James Goodale led the case for The New York Times in 1971 and won.  This First Amendment decision will hold forever:  the government cannot restrain the press from publishing (censorship).

Pentagon Papers Panel Hosted by CJR March 16, 2010
The Columbia Journalism Review hosted a performance of the play TOP SECRET: The Battle for the Pentagon Papers by Geoffrey Cowan and Leroy Aarons, originally produced by LA Theatre Works in 2010.

After the play, a talkback panel took place on stage between Nicholas Lemann, James Goodale, Leslie Gelb and Daniel Ellsberg. It was moderated by Victor Navasky.   Click to Watch the complete panel, including a Q&A at the end featuring Carl Bernstein, Amy Goodman, Peter Osnos, Geoffrey Cowan and Steven Haft.
